Kelly Pettit on Instagram: "Salty Watermelon Paloma 🍉🧂🍋🟩🫧 My viral salty watermelon marg was a favorite last year so naturally I had to recreate it as a paloma for Cinco de Mayo! 2 oz tequila 2 oz watermelon juice 1 oz grapefruit juice .5 oz lime juice .5 oz agave Pinch of flaky sea salt Sparkling water Method: add all ingredients except sparkling water to a cocktail shaker with ice and shake for 10 seconds. Rim a tall glass with chamoy and flaky sea salt. Add ice and strain cocktail into glass. Top with sparkling water and garnish with a watermelon slice. *watermelon juice: dice watermelon and add to a blender. Blend until smooth. Cortney LaCorte on Instagram: "Hot Honey Peach Margarita🍑🍋🟩🍹 Ingredients: 4 peach slices + an extra for garnish 2.5 ounces of reposado tequila 1.25 ounces fresh lime juice 1 ounce orange liquor like Cointreau (Triple Sec would also be fine) 2-3 dash of peach bitters 1.5 tsp spicy or hot honey Sugar for rimming the glass Sprig of mint or basil for garnish (optional) Directions: Rim a cocktail glass with lime juice and sugar, fill with ice and set aside. In a cocktail shaker, muddle together peaches, spicy honey and peach bitters. After muddling, add ice, tequila, Cointreau, lime juice and shake the cocktail shaker.
